Remote red-earth work punishes any gap in the plant plan. When the nearest dealer workshop is a day's drive away, the machine you hire has to arrive complete, stay running on fine abrasive dust and be supported by people who understand what isolation means for breakdowns.
01 / Why distance changes the hire decision
On a metropolitan job, a failed hydraulic hose is an inconvenience measured in hours. On a pastoral station access road or a remote mine haul road upgrade, the same failure can idle a crew for days while parts travel by road freight or charter. That shifts the priority from the cheapest hourly rate to the most dependable machine and the most capable support arrangement. Ask early how the supplier will service the unit, where their nearest field technician is based and whether they hold critical spares regionally or only in a capital city.
Distance also changes the economics of mobilisation. Float costs, escort requirements and driver hours can rival a month of hire on a small scope, so it often makes sense to hire fewer, more versatile machines for longer rather than cycling units in and out. A tool carrier or a mid-size excavator with a quick hitch and several buckets may serve better than a string of single-purpose machines that each need their own trip.
02 / Selecting machines for abrasive red dust
The fine iron-rich dust common across the Pilbara, Kimberley, central Australia and western Queensland gets into everything. Specify machines with cyclonic pre-cleaners, dual-element air filters with a safety element, and air filter restriction indicators the operator can read from the cab. Pressurised, sealed cabins with functioning door seals are not a comfort item here: they protect the operator's lungs and keep dust away from electronic controls. Ask whether the unit has recently had cab filters and seals replaced rather than assuming it has.
Cooling capacity matters as much as filtration. Radiators and oil coolers packed with dust will push operating temperatures up quickly in inland heat, so reversing cooling fans or easily accessible core cleaning points are worth asking about. For earthworks, consider whether wheeled loaders and graders suit the long, dry formation work better than tracked plant, which wears faster on abrasive, rocky ground and is slower to relocate between work fronts spread over many kilometres.
03 / Mobilisation, permits and access
Most mid-size and larger plant moves on a float, and loads that exceed standard dimension or mass limits generally need a permit through the National Heavy Vehicle Regulator or the relevant state road authority. Route surveys matter on unsealed roads, floodways and grids, and some routes have seasonal closures. Confirm who holds responsibility for the permit, pilot vehicles and any road condition checks, and allow for the reality that a closed road can hold a machine in transit longer than planned.
Build site access into the brief as well. If the float cannot reach the work front, the supplier needs to know where machines will be unloaded and how they will walk in. Clarify whether a supplier's transport rate includes return travel, loading delays and waiting time. On remote work, these terms are where quotes that looked similar on paper start to diverge sharply.
04 / Fuel, fluids and field servicing
Fuel logistics can quietly determine productivity. Decide whether the hirer or the supplier supplies diesel, how it will be stored and transferred on site, and whether a self-bunded fuel cube or service truck is part of the package. Contaminated fuel from poorly managed drums is a common cause of injector problems, so filtration at the point of transfer and clear storage procedures are worth writing into the plan and the site environmental controls.
Service intervals on dusty remote jobs often need to come forward. Ask the supplier what their recommended adjustment is for severe dust duty, who performs daily greasing and filter checks, and whether an oil sampling program is in place so wear metals show up before a failure. Agree in writing which consumables sit with the hirer and which with the supplier, and keep a small stock of filters, hoses and ground engaging tools on site.
05 / Operator welfare and communications
Remote operators work long rosters in heat, glare and isolation, often far from medical help. Confirm the cab air conditioning is sized for the conditions and working before the machine leaves the yard, and make sure drinking water, shade and rest breaks are planned rather than improvised. If the supplier provides a wet-hire operator, check their fatigue management arrangements, accommodation, travel time and familiarity with remote work, because a capable metropolitan operator may not be ready for a month on an isolated camp.
Mobile coverage is patchy or absent across much of remote Australia. Satellite phones, UHF radio protocols, personal locator beacons and a clear emergency response plan should be settled before mobilisation. Machines fitted with telematics can help the supplier see fault codes and hours remotely, but only where coverage or satellite connectivity allows, so ask how the data will actually reach them.
06 / Questions to put to remote suppliers
Ask each supplier to describe their last few remote jobs and how they handled breakdowns. Useful questions include: where is your nearest technician and service vehicle, what is your realistic response time to this location, which spares will travel with the machine, and what happens to the hire rate while a unit is down awaiting parts. Answers that are vague on these points are a warning sign regardless of the quoted rate.
It is also worth asking whether the supplier will accept a local contractor or dealer carrying out urgent repairs under their direction, and how that is authorised and paid. Pre-agreeing this avoids a machine sitting idle while two parties argue over approvals. Finally, ask how the machine will be inspected and cleaned at demobilisation, since dust, damage and missing tools are easier to resolve with photographs taken on arrival.
Field checklist
- Confirm pre-cleaners, dual-element air filters, cab pressurisation and working air conditioning before dispatch.
- Agree a severe-dust service schedule and who carries out daily checks and greasing.
- Pack a site spares kit: filters, common hoses, cutting edges, teeth and fuses.
- Settle float permits, route checks and responsibility for road closures in writing.
- Document fuel supply, storage and filtration arrangements.
- Put satellite communications and an emergency response plan in place before operators arrive.
- Clarify how breakdown time is treated in the hire rate and who approves local repairs.
- Photograph each machine on arrival to support the off-hire inspection.
Frequently asked questions
Is it better to dry hire or wet hire plant for remote red-earth work?
It depends on your in-house capability. Wet hire places operator skill, fatigue management and basic machine care with the supplier, which can suit short remote scopes. Dry hire can be more economical on long programs if you have experienced operators and a fitter available. Either way, clarify who is responsible for daily checks, because remote breakdowns are expensive for everyone.
How often should filters be changed on dusty remote sites?
There is no single answer, as it depends on the machine, the dust load and the manufacturer's severe-duty guidance. Many operators check air filter restriction indicators daily and blow out or replace elements far more often than the standard schedule suggests. Ask the supplier for their recommended interval for your conditions and record every change in the machine log.
Who pays if a hired machine breaks down at a remote site?
Most hire agreements place the cost of mechanical failure from fair wear on the supplier and damage from misuse on the hirer, but the detail varies. The bigger issue is downtime: check whether hire charges stop while the machine is unserviceable, and whether the supplier commits to a response time for your location.
Do I need a permit to float an excavator to a remote site?
Smaller machines on suitable trailers may travel within standard limits, while larger excavators, dozers and graders often exceed dimension or mass limits and need a permit. Requirements depend on the combination, route and state, so ask the transport provider to confirm what applies and who will obtain it well before your mobilisation date.
